axure中怎么使用字符串函數(shù)?

對于初次使用axure,且沒有變成經(jīng)驗(yàn)的同學(xué)來說,函數(shù)是一個(gè)門檻。希望下面的示例對你有幫助。

快速產(chǎn)品原型設(shè)計(jì)工具 Axure RP Pro v7.0.0.3174 漢化綠色版
- 類型:應(yīng)用其它
- 大?。?/span>8.97MB
- 語言:簡體中文
- 時(shí)間:2014-12-22
一、設(shè)置界面布局
在工作區(qū)添加元件:
矩形(最底層)
文本框(strinput)
文本框(strout)
文本(標(biāo)題)
按鈕(提交)
二、字符串函數(shù)演示及說明
函數(shù):length;含義:返回字符串的長度
用途:多用于判斷字符串的長度,對比長度等
按照下圖示:
給“提交”按鈕添加交互用例“鼠標(biāo)點(diǎn)擊時(shí)”,設(shè)置文本為值,并按照圖示設(shè)置局部變量,在插入函數(shù)中插入:[[LVAR1.length]],然后F5,預(yù)覽,并輸入測試字符,如下圖
函數(shù):charAt(index);含義:返回index位置的字符,index為參數(shù),index值范圍:0~(length-1);
用途:多用獲取字符串中指定位置的字符
按照第一步所示:添加局部變量,然后插入并編寫函數(shù):[[LVAR1.charAt(0)]]-[[LVAR1.charAt(5)]]-[[LVAR1.charAt(LVAR1.length-1)]]
說明“-" 為連接符,不起任何意義。
按下F5預(yù)覽效果如下:
函數(shù):charCodeAt(index);含義:返回index位置字符的Unicode編碼,index為參數(shù),index值范圍:0~(length-1);
用途:多用獲取字符串中指定位置的字符的Unicode編碼,區(qū)別于 charAt(index)
先看預(yù)覽效果:1--》49 5 --》54 0--》48
設(shè)置變量,插入函數(shù):[[LVAR1.charCodeAt(0)]]-[[LVAR1.charCodeAt(5)]]-[[LVAR1.charCodeAt(LVAR1.length-1)]]
函數(shù):concat("string");含義:連接字符串,返回連接后的字符結(jié)果;
用途:多用于累加字符串
按照下圖插入函數(shù):[[LVAR1.concat('測試字符串連接')]],并預(yù)覽。
函數(shù):indexOf('string');含義:返回查找的字符串第一次出現(xiàn)的位置,如果未找到則返回為-1
用途:驗(yàn)證字符串,或查找指定字符
函數(shù):[[LVAR1.indexOf('A')]],[[LVAR1.indexOf('1')]],[[LVAR1.indexOf('5')]],[[LVAR1.indexOf('9')]]
函數(shù):lastindexOf('string');含義:返回查找的字符串最后一次出現(xiàn)的位置,如果未找到則返回為-1
用途:驗(yàn)證字符串,或查找指定字符
函數(shù):[[LVAR1.lastIndexOf('A')]],[[LVAR1.lastIndexOf('8')]]
F5預(yù)覽,查看效果。
本次先說明此6個(gè)函數(shù),下篇經(jīng)驗(yàn)繼續(xù)講解剩余函數(shù)。
注意事項(xiàng):
對于函數(shù)的使用,請多加聯(lián)系,如果本章對您有用請投個(gè)票哦,謝謝!
相關(guān)推薦:
Axure設(shè)計(jì)的原型怎么一鍵生成網(wǎng)站結(jié)構(gòu)圖?
Axure8怎么設(shè)計(jì)點(diǎn)擊按鈕觸發(fā)控件變化的交互效果?
相關(guān)文章
- axure8中繼器怎么添加數(shù)據(jù)?axure8中經(jīng)常制作網(wǎng)頁原型,該怎么給中繼器添加數(shù)據(jù)呢?下面我們就來看看詳細(xì)的教程,需要的朋友可以參考下2016-11-26
Axure8怎么設(shè)計(jì)點(diǎn)擊按鈕觸發(fā)控件變化的交互效果?
Axure8怎么設(shè)計(jì)點(diǎn)擊按鈕觸發(fā)控件變化的交互效果?Axure8中想要制作一個(gè)網(wǎng)頁效果就是,點(diǎn)擊按鈕可以發(fā)生一些變化,該怎么設(shè)計(jì)呢?下面我們就來看看詳細(xì)的教程,需要的朋友可2016-11-25Axure怎么新建元件庫? Axure創(chuàng)建自己元件庫的教程
Axure怎么新建元件庫?Axure繪制網(wǎng)頁原型很簡單,繪制的時(shí)候需要很多原件,想創(chuàng)建自己的元件庫,該怎么創(chuàng)建呢?下面我們就來看看Axure創(chuàng)建自己元件庫的教程,需要的朋友可2016-11-18- Axure部件庫怎么導(dǎo)入下載的部件?經(jīng)常使用axure繪制網(wǎng)頁原型,但是axure中自帶的部件款式不多,想導(dǎo)入自己下載的部件,該怎么導(dǎo)入呢?下面我們就來看看詳細(xì)的教程,需要的2016-11-18
axure拖動(dòng)動(dòng)態(tài)面板怎么設(shè)計(jì)? axure給動(dòng)態(tài)面板添加拖動(dòng)條的兩種方法
axure拖動(dòng)動(dòng)態(tài)面板怎么設(shè)計(jì)?axure設(shè)計(jì)動(dòng)態(tài) 面板的時(shí)候,發(fā)現(xiàn)沒有拖動(dòng)條,想添加,該怎么做呢?下面我們就來介紹axure給動(dòng)態(tài)面板添加拖動(dòng)條的兩種方法,需要的朋友可以參考2016-11-03- axure8怎么制作tab菜單選中的效果?axure8做原型的時(shí)候,想要讓玄真過得菜單高亮顯示,該怎么社會自呢?下面我們就來看看詳細(xì)的設(shè)置教程,需要的朋友可以參考下2016-11-02
- Axure7.0怎么制作折疊菜單原型?再設(shè)計(jì)網(wǎng)頁原型的時(shí)候,想設(shè)計(jì)一個(gè)折疊的菜單,該怎么設(shè)計(jì)呢?下面我們就來看看Axure7.0設(shè)計(jì)折疊菜單的教程,需要的朋友可以參考下2016-11-02
- axure怎么制作彈出框效果?想要給網(wǎng)頁實(shí)現(xiàn)一個(gè)彈出框的效果,該怎么設(shè)計(jì)這個(gè)原型呢?下面我們就來看看詳細(xì)的教程,需要的朋友可以參考下2016-10-26
axure RP7.0怎么制作60秒倒計(jì)時(shí)效果?
axure RP7.0怎么制作60秒倒計(jì)時(shí)效果?我們經(jīng)常使用axure設(shè)計(jì)網(wǎng)頁原型,該怎么使用axure制作網(wǎng)頁倒計(jì)時(shí)60秒的效果呢?請看下文詳細(xì)介紹,需要的朋友可以參考下2016-10-26Axure設(shè)計(jì)圖片輪番播放效果的網(wǎng)頁原型的教程
想設(shè)計(jì)一個(gè)網(wǎng)頁原型,該怎么設(shè)計(jì)呢?下面我們就來看看使用Axure設(shè)計(jì)圖片輪番播放效果的網(wǎng)頁原型的教程,很簡單,需要的朋友可以參考下2016-10-23